Newark Castle station ensures ease of travel with its well-facilitated ticketing services. The station operates a ticket office on weekdays from 6:00 to 14:00 and on Saturdays from 7:00 to 15:00, though it remains closed on Sundays. Ticket machines are also present, allowing passengers to collect tickets bought online at any time. For those who require assistance, there's an induction loop available.
Accessibility is partially available, with step-free access to both platforms via ramps, although passengers should be cautious of the uneven surfaces caused by railway tracks. Despite the absence of accessible restrooms, the presence of tactile paving on Platform 1 is a step towards inclusive travel.
While it may lack extensive shopping options, Newark Castle station does not disappoint with its local refreshment facility. Carriages Cafe, located on the Nottingham bound platform, provides a cozy spot for a snack or drink while you await your train. Unfortunately, there's no ATM or currency exchange at the station, so it’s wise to prepare ahead.

Newark Castle ensures your vehicle is in safe hands, with a parking facility operated by East Midlands Railway. The parking area is open 24/7 and features 69 spaces with a few accessible spots. For budget-conscious travelers, attractive parking charges start at £4.00 for a day.
Bicycle enthusiasts will find ample space to secure their ride, with 40 covered bike stands monitored by CCTV. Though cycle hire isn't available at the station, cyclists can confidently secure their bikes during their travels.

Carshalton station provides a range of facilities to ensure a smooth and comfortable journey. The ticket office operates with generous hours throughout the week, coupled with ticket machines for quick and easy purchases. For those picking up tickets bought online, these can conveniently be collected from the ticket machine, which also accommodates disc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ders.
Accessibility is a priority here. The station offers step-free access through lifts across all platforms, making it a Category A station. For assistance, there is a help point on the platforms and a staffed ramp to facilitate train access. Although there are no waiting rooms or wheelchairs available, seating areas are provided for passenger comfort.
